    We went to the steakhouse for dinner. $35 per person and includes gratuity. The people that work here were all very very friendly. They knew we were celebrating my birthday and they brought us all a glass of champagne. How nice!! Before our appetizers came they gave everyone a complementary mini hamburger slider. I am not sure if you can tell the size by the pic but it is about the size of a half dollar. Cute and tasty. See below for some some pictures of our appetizers: salad, tuna tartare, pork belly, shrimp cocktail. This meal was off to a great start but it was about to get better much, much better. Our yummy entrées were the cowboy steak, the surf and turf and the wagyu steak. We had mashed potatoes, onion rings, mushrooms and macaroni and cheese for the sides. Everything we had was VERY delicious but probably the wagyu was the best of all. For dessert we opted to get the table art. This is a pretty cool experience where the chef comes to your table and creates edible art right there on a very large cutting board.The centerpiece of the art is the chocolate sphere. They also gave us a free bottle of house wine for visiting on the first night or we could’ve had any other bottle of wine for 50% off. Since we had just purchased the vineyards package we decided just to go with the free one. It was OK. Not great, but not bad. I let DH drink most of it.

  5. Initial impression of ship. Very clean. Pretty. Much more toned down than many of Carnival’s ships. I didn’t miss huge atrium with glass elevators. I know many do. We enjoyed funnel screen. Made our way to the room. Mid ship balcony on lido deck 10264. Great location....very close to lido but couldn’t hear it....,Nice decor, room seems wider than others we’ve had, frig worked well, nice size tv, nice temp (some ships have rooms that are so hot) handy shelves on vanity, nice long mirror on the inside of the closet door. There is extra storage on the bottom of the couch. It has two pull out drawers. Not as much closet space as other Carnival ships. Thank goodness we always bring extra hangers ( that I leave in the room) as we sure needed them!! Also, I’m really missing not having a reading light on the back of the bed. The only light you can use for this is the bedside lamp and it puts out way too much light for the other person in the room to be comfortable napping/sleeping while the other reads. The room is fine for 3 but if we had 4 it would be tight.

  15. Save your excursion money for other ports of call. Grand Turk has a fabulous free HUGE swimming pool right at the end of the pier, and also a free beach at the pier (with free loungers). And with your large group, some members might be casino players, and Grand Turk is one of very few ports where the ship's casino is open while the ship is docked (and is less smoky because most passengers are off the ship).
